Maybe we're doing wrong the process. The truth is that I (we) never did this before. We want to configure AppDynamics in an Amazon RDS MySQL instance. Amazon does not let you install anything on DB, so no DB agent is installed. This means that no DB_agent can be started and no DB_agent logs are available, so we won't be able to attach any agent.log.
What we have done, so far, is to configure the MySQL RDS instance in Amazon side. It is done to use a DB in a cloud environment in Amazon AWS, to ease management and throughput issues in AWS (but I'm sure you also know this). It doesn't matter if you will be using AppDynamics later or not...
After that, in AppDynamics Controller, we acceeded Databases menu and added a new Collector. We have to add that we didn't see such UI that is shown in "Step 1" from section "Monitor Your Database With AppD4DB" in https://blog.appdynamics.com/database/how-to-set-up-and-monitor-amazon-rds-databases/ (We understand that this AppD4DB design is only a matter of UI). We have to add, also, that we have never seen any AppD4DB reference anywhere inside the Controller.
Anyway, to avoid confusing ourselves, what about if we start again from the beginning? We have the RDS MySQL instance configured, no possibility to install any DB_agent... next step?
